Telefund
Each year, more than 30 UWM students work for the Telefund program. Using an automated calling system, the students contact more than 35,000 alumni and friends of the University about annual giving and to give updates.
Alumni typically are contacted on behalf of their respective school or college. The money raised allows the deans to address the most pressing needs while taking advantage of emerging opportunities. In 2007, calling efforts produced more than 5,600 gifts.
The students at the Telefund learn firsthand how their education is impacted by the generous donations of thousands of alumni and friends by interacting with donors on a one-to-one basis.
